Mexborough and Swinton Times July 22, 1927
Swinton’s Best
Darton Overwhelmed
Swinton again found easy prey when they entertained Darton on Saturday. Darton arrived without three or four of their regular men, including Wilde and Brooke and gave a terribly weak exhibition with the bat.
On a quite good wicket they were dismissed in 26 overs by Pearson and Thompson for 32. Pearson took five wickets for 12 runs and Thompson (picture) four for 18.
Hart and Heaton comfortably hit off the runs and play was continued until 6 o’clock when Swinton were 106 for 1 (Hart 42)
